Subject: Major performance regressions in 3.7rc1/2

Hi,

I'm using an Asus Zenbook UX31E and have been installing all RCs in
hope of improving the Wireless and Touchpad functionality.
However, when trying 3.7 (rc1 and now rc2) I have major performance issues.

Easiest way to reproduce is to launch and play a game like Nexuiz,
where the computer will lag, stutter and freeze until the machine is
unresponsive within a couple of minutes.
But an easy workload like browsing will also cause lags when switching
tabs or redrawing a web page after a tab switch.
Basically 3.7 is unusable for this machine.

I have been installing the pre-built kernels from
http://kernel.ubuntu.com/~kernel-ppa/mainline/
